Nairobi protesters calling for DIG Lagat resignation attacked by gangs

A gang has temporarily foiled a protest calling for the resignation of Deputy Inspector General Eliud Lagat.

The anti-Lagat protestors who were marching in Nairobi CBD had to scamper for safety as the gangs on boda boda accosted them.

The camp which arrived in gusto on several motorbikes cornered the protesters who were peacefully marching towards the Central Police Station at the University Way intersection and disrupted the protest.

The anti-Lagat protesters had to disappear in thin air leaving the rival camp to take control and rule as they whisked away and flogging the defiant remnants on the road.

Police cars and officers could be seen witnessing how the gangs were chasing and roughing up protesters.

Earlier on, police had lobbed teargas canisters to disperse the crowd which had gathered at the Nation Centre where rage started.

The tension has since paralysed business activities within the town with shops already closed.
